Responsibilities

Tasks

  • Compile and analyze data on factors affecting land use
  • Confer with appropriate authorities and interest groups to formulate and develop land use or community plans
  • Prepare and recommend land development concepts and plans for zoning, subdivisions, transportation, public utilities, community facilities, parks, agricultural and other land uses
  • Prepare plans for environmental protection
  • Present plans to civic, rural and regional authorities and hold public meetings
  • Review and evaluate proposals for land use and development plans and prepare recommendations
  • Process application for land development permits
  • Administer land use plans and zoning by-laws
  • Formulate long-range objectives and policies relative to future land use and the protection of the environment
  • Conduct research
  • Plan, organize, direct, control and evaluate daily operations
